Home Alone named Ireland’s favourite Christmas movie in Festive film survey

With Christmas just around the corner, ODEON Cinemas commissioned a nationwide festive film survey that offers a revealing snapshot of Ireland’s favourite Christmas movies.

Home Alone has officially been crowned Ireland’s number one must watch Christmas movie, according to a new festive film survey that highlights the nation’s enduring love affair with seasonal classics. The research reveals that Christmas movie watching is not just a tradition but a full blown ritual for many households, with 44 percent of Irish people admitting they have watched their favourite festive film more than 20 times.

The survey shows that Christmas movie season properly begins in early December for half of the population, while 14 percent start as early as November. A committed 21 percent believe Christmas films are not seasonal at all and can be enjoyed at any time of year. This flexibility reflects Ireland’s relaxed and enthusiastic approach to festive viewing.

Home Alone secured 34 percent of the vote as the country’s favourite Christmas film, comfortably ahead of Love Actually, The Grinch and Elf. The popularity of the film extends beyond its lead character, with Kevin McCallister also named Ireland’s favourite Christmas movie character overall. The Wet Bandits, meanwhile, were voted the most memorable villains by 36 percent of respondents.

Rewatching festive films is clearly part of the magic. Alongside the 44 percent who have seen their favourite more than 20 times, a further 19 percent said they had watched theirs between 11 and 20 times. Only one person admitted to watching their favourite Christmas film just once.

Comedy emerged as Ireland’s favourite festive genre at 49 percent, followed closely by romantic comedies at 41 percent. Action films accounted for 9 percent, while a brave 1 percent opted for horror during the festive season.

One quote stood out above all others, with 61 percent choosing “Merry Christmas, ya filthy animal” as the most iconic Christmas movie line. When it comes to snacks, popcorn remains the firm favourite, followed by selection boxes and tubs of Roses.

Asked who they would most like to watch a Christmas classic with, 35 percent chose Nicola Coughlan as their top celebrity companion. Cinema trips remain a key part of the festive experience, with most people heading out at least once or twice over Christmas.
